India's Agricultural Sector: A New Era of Global Exports

India’s agricultural sector is undergoing a significant transformation, marked by the first-ever exports of various farm products to new global markets. Under the Aatmanirbhar Bharat initiative, Indian farmers are gaining unprecedented access to international markets, leading to increased incomes and greater recognition of India’s diverse agro-products. These landmark shipments highlight India’s growing prominence in global trade and showcase the immense potential of Indian agriculture.

Notable First-Time Agricultural Exports

  • Pomegranates to Australia: The first sea shipments of premium Sangola and Bhagwa pomegranates have been sent.
  • Fig Juice to Poland: India's GI-tagged Purandar figs have reached European markets.
  • Dragon Fruit to London & Bahrain: Sourced from Gujarat and West Bengal, expanding the range of fruit exports.
  • Fresh Pomegranates to the USA: Trial shipment of Maharashtra’s Bhagwa pomegranates.
  • Leteku (Burmese Grapes) to Dubai: Assam’s exotic fruit has entered the Gulf market.
  • Jackfruit to Germany: The first fresh jackfruit shipment from Tripura has been dispatched.
  • Raja Mircha (King Chilli) to London: The GI-tagged Nagaland chilli has reached the UK.
  • Red Rice to the USA: Iron-rich Assamese ‘Bao-dhaan’ rice has been exported.
  • Vazhakulam Pineapple to Dubai & Sharjah: Kerala’s GI-tagged pineapple has gained global recognition.

Factors Contributing to India's Expanding Agricultural Exports

Several factors have played a crucial role in the expansion of India’s agricultural exports. Government initiatives, improved farming techniques, the expansion of organic farming, and better market access have all contributed significantly. Schemes such as the Agriculture Export Policy and increased trade agreements have also been pivotal.

The Significance of First-Time Exports for Indian Farmers

These first-time exports are significant as they create new revenue opportunities, increase global demand for Indian agro-products, and encourage farmers to enhance quality and diversify their produce.

Government Support in Facilitating Exports

The Indian government has been instrumental in supporting these exports by facilitating trade agreements, streamlining export procedures, providing financial assistance, and promoting GI-tagged products globally. Initiatives like APEDA (Agricultural and Processed Food Products Export Development Authority) have further strengthened India’s agricultural trade.

Regional Benefits from New Exports

Regions such as the Northeastern states, Maharashtra, Gujarat, Assam, Kerala, and West Bengal have seen notable growth in agricultural exports due to their unique produce.

Impact on India's Global Trade Position

The increase in agricultural exports is solidifying India’s position as a key supplier in international markets, enhancing its global presence in the food and agro-product sectors.

Challenges and Future Prospects

Despite logistical challenges, the perishable nature of products, stringent international quality standards, and competition from other exporting nations, India’s technological advancements and policy support are helping to overcome these obstacles. The future prospects for Indian agricultural exports are promising, with growing demand for organic and specialty products expected to further benefit farmers and strengthen the rural economy.
